Understanding Community Development
Community development encompasses a variety of strategies aimed at improving the economic, social, and environmental conditions of a community. These programs focus on:
- Empowerment: Equipping individuals with skills and knowledge to improve their livelihoods.
- Collaboration: Encouraging partnerships among local stakeholders, including government, NGOs, and residents.
- Sustainability: Ensuring that the benefits of programs last for future generations.
Key Community Development Programs in Durban
Here are some notable community development programs operating in Durban:
1. Education Support Initiatives
Programs focused on education aim to enhance literacy and learning opportunities for children and adults. They may include tutoring, scholarships, and vocational training.
2. Economic Development Projects
These initiatives foster job creation through entrepreneurship support, skills training, and funding for small businesses. By equipping community members with tangible skills, they can contribute to the local economy.
3. Health and Wellness Programs
Health-focused programs provide access to essential healthcare services, nutrition education, and wellness workshops, promoting healthier lifestyles within the community.
4. Environmental Sustainability Initiatives
These programs aim to improve the local environment through clean-up drives, recycling initiatives, and sustainable agriculture practices, encouraging residents to take an active role in protecting their surroundings.
